Transaction 64b950fe72c07e844ea49f7d3dc439f171b868df315c2f1bb12da98b15b06a0e

1 Input
2 Outputs
  • 64b950fe72c07e844ea49f7d3dc439f171b868df315c2f1bb12da98b15b06a0e:0
  • value  161564
    address  1KQKFPie3zfnNGzEnfSXtmPf29ftwU1y7r
  • 64b950fe72c07e844ea49f7d3dc439f171b868df315c2f1bb12da98b15b06a0e:1
  • value  13062989
    address  1PfCZ1AHPTgfmBbBNuoioG2ZdFDFyGEMhh